Hurricanes Imelda and Humberto Threaten US East Coast with Strong Waves and Flooding

Bermuda is preparing for Hurricane Imelda, which is strengthening and expected to pass close to the island early Thursday morning with winds potentially reaching Category 2 strength, and may transition into a powerful extratropical storm with dangerous winds, while the Atlantic remains relatively quiet overall.

"California Braces for Deadly Flood Threat from Brutal Atmospheric River Storm"

California is facing a dangerous storm with hurricane-force winds and substantial flooding, prompting evacuation orders and power outages affecting over 242,000 customers. The first-ever hurricane-force wind warning was issued in northern California, with forecasts of up to 15 inches of rainfall in Los Angeles. The storm, known as a "Pineapple Express," has led to a state of emergency declaration in eight counties and the cancellation of a professional golf tournament. The National Weather Service has warned of major flash flooding, dangerous winds, and the potential for landslides, urging residents to take precautions and evacuate as necessary.
